Ordinals
beta
Sat 1346770135133056
decimal
328708.135133056
degree
0°118708′100″135133056‴
percentile
64.13191126735732%
name
ehrxurfwnaf
cycle
0
epoch
1
period
163
block
328708
offset
135133056
timestamp
2014-11-05 20:50:59 UTC
rarity
common
prev
next